A: First confirm the invalidation actually propagated by checking the Quillmap coordinator's epoch counter against the edge nodes. If they disagree, do not restart the edge nodes individually — that causes a thundering-herd refill against the render farm. Instead, use the coordinated flush tool, which drains traffic first. The tool requires the cache-admin recovery passphrase before it will issue the flush command. The current passphrase is below.

vault phrase of taweg-kafof = oliax-zorael

# Zero-downtime schema migration constants for the Harrowfield billing DB.
# Support note: migrations run in expand/contract phases, so both old and
# new columns coexist for a window. If a customer reports mixed-schema
# errors, check that the contract phase hasn't started early. These
# timeouts and batch sizes were chosen to keep replication lag under the
# alerting threshold during business hours. The constants follow.

tuning constants:
QUOTAS = {
    "druwyn": 5,
    "holix": 5,
    "zorath": 5,
    "holwyn": 10,
}

Subject: On-call handover — Feedwright validator

Hey Priya,

Quiet-ish week. Feedwright kept flagging valid podcast feeds with odd namespace prefixes — I muted the alert and filed a ticket. One customer's enclosure URLs fail checksum validation; workaround is in the ticket notes. Re-run the validator queue if it backs up past 500 items. Any escalations should go straight to the validator team's shared inbox.

escalation mailbox, bafog-fafog: ulador@paliqlabs.internal